Ehtisham Zaidi, Sr Director Analyst, Gartner
The purpose of data catalogs is to organize the thousands or millions of an organization’s data sets to help users perform searches for specific data and understand its metadata, such as data lineage, uses, and how others perceive the data’s value (or lack of). Data catalog implementations can vary depending on the use-case requirements, tool capabilities and maturity of each organization. There are also many vendor solutions and technology options through which companies can add data cataloging capabilities to their existing data management architecture.
This session will help D&A Leaders & other participants understand the past, present and future of Data Catalogs. Provide answers to their questions, technology trends, available technology options, pricing trends, implementation trends etc.

Ted Friedman, Distinguished VP Analyst, Gartner
Confusion persists regarding the role of data warehouses, data lakes and data hubs. They are NOT the same. While the names and terminology are less important than the principles and capabilities, data and analytics leaders need to know the capabilities and the value they provide. This session explains:
● What are data warehouses, data lakes and data hubs?
● What are the key differences between these concepts?
● How can they be used in combination to meet modern data and analytics needs?

Tuesday, 16 June, 2020 / 09:45 AM - 10:30 AM CEST
Ehtisham Zaidi, Sr Director Analyst, Gartner
Data and analytics leaders are often tasked to investigate, adopt and later integrate a huge number of data management "point solutions" and tools for their operational and analytical use case requirements. This often leads to redundant purchases, integration challenges and derailed projects. Convergence in data integration, data quality, data preparation, data cataloging and other tools is paving a way for a core active metadata informed and ML-enabled dynamic data fabric design that can potentially transform data management and integration. This session covers:
1. What does a data fabric architecture mean for data and analytics leaders and how can they enable it?
2. What are the vendors and market offerings that can potentially fast track a data fabric design?
3. How can data and analytics leaders enable a data fabric without disrupting existing architectures and without creating a governance chaos?
